Parks & Nature

Seattle's most beautiful park! it has a reservoir with view of the space needle and beautiful grounds for walking, throwing a frisbee around, or picnicking. climb the 3-story historic brick water tower for great views of the city. the park also contains a historic plant conservatory and the Seattle Asian Art Museum.
563 recommandé par les habitants
Volunteer Park
1247 15th Ave E
563 recommandé par les habitants
Seattle's most beautiful park! it has a reservoir with view of the space needle and beautiful grounds for walking, throwing a frisbee around, or picnicking. climb the 3-story historic brick water tower for great views of the city. the park also contains a historic plant conservatory and the Seattle Asian Art Museum.

Arts & Culture

skip the downstairs and head upstairs to learn about Seattle's history. make sure to catch a screening in the fire theater to learn about the Great Seattle Fire of 1889 (not to be missed). outside you can explore an antique tugboat and see great views of Lake Union.
357 recommandé par les habitants
Museum of History & Industry (MOHAI)
860 Terry Ave N
357 recommandé par les habitants
skip the downstairs and head upstairs to learn about Seattle's history. make sure to catch a screening in the fire theater to learn about the Great Seattle Fire of 1889 (not to be missed). outside you can explore an antique tugboat and see great views of Lake Union.
a tiny natural history and culture museum on the University of Washington campus. see a giant sloth fossil dug up at SeaTac airport (cool!) and learn about volcanoes, the native flora and fauna, and the indigenous peoples of the Pacific Northwest.
123 recommandé par les habitants
Burke Museum of Natural History and Culture
4303 15th Ave NE
123 recommandé par les habitants
a tiny natural history and culture museum on the University of Washington campus. see a giant sloth fossil dug up at SeaTac airport (cool!) and learn about volcanoes, the native flora and fauna, and the indigenous peoples of the Pacific Northwest.
